There is an issue with "plrdisable" on Windows 8.
Does anyone know about this? Couldn't find anything in any posts.
I am starting with a tutorial guide game- it begins with a "plrdisable" and writing hud gui text to screen.
This is using etimer to pause player walking until the gui fades out.
Works on XP, XPPro, Win7, and W... oops Win8 simply freezes the keyboard and never returns control! If you load a save game that was saved previously on another non-Win8 system- it returns keyboard control.
Tried etimer and timer...
Does anyone know- does plrfreeze cause the same issue?
Is there a Windows 8-Safe way to freeze the player for timed pause then giving back control to the keyboard?
Compatibility mode Win7,WinXP etc does not resolve.

I'm creating a loading routine with the intro video encrypted in the exe along with the FPSC exe. It works fine on XP of all kinds, but so far haven't found a video codec that works in Win7 and Win8.

I'm not talking about the typical "what vid should I use with my FPSC game?" issue-
The program I'm using to create the loading routine is MultiMedia Fusion 2. It needs AVI. AVI is supposed to be considered the standard. Earlier machines up to Vista are supposed to be able to load Indeo or Cinepak even if Media Player is not present. Neither of these would load on Win8-ridiculous.
So, I tried DivX- currently considered the most commonly used codec- Won't load on Win8.
Tried XVid- won't load on Win7 or Win8.
Now... it is possible that vids on their own will work- have more testing to do, but MM2 is one of the best compatibility programs even if a year older than current testing.
If I were not using MM2 to load vid, I would opt for WMV converted from a higher format, bc it is specifically designed for Windows Media Video. But, I can't do that the way I hope in MM2.

Microsoft in there great wisdom don't have many codec support with standard windows 7 or 8 and windows 8 has even less support not even will it play dvd's with out codecs being installed from a 3rd party software.

I use wmv for video and runs fine for me in windows 8 as like you said it standard.

To play all formats I downloaded a program called klite codec pack and that makes window 7 and 8 play anything you push at it and works great.
